Purpose

The Senior Manager, Product Communication & Experience is responsible for developing and implementing mutual fund and investment communications, tools, training, and other content-rich support to grow and retain proprietary fund market share and enhance the overall advisor and client experience. The scope of the role spans Canadian retail banking, Scotia Financial Planning, Independent Dealer, and Wealth Management channels and extends to multiple brands, wholesaling, advisor, and client audiences.

The position requires a strong understanding of mutual fund, ETF, and managed assets product mechanics, investing principles, and innovation trends in asset management. Thorough knowledge of investment fund products and the Canadian regulatory framework (NI 81-102), strong written and verbal communication skills, the ability to tailor content to meet the needs of multiple distribution channels, and experience managing complex projects and processes is required. The role also requires demonstrated experience working collaboratively in a multi-disciplinary environment to develop compelling communications and launching comprehensive product support aligned with key project milestones.


What you will be doing:

Product Communication: Develop persuasive product communication and support for advisor and client audiences, leveraging strong product knowledge, deep understanding of priority channels, and excellent creative and copywriting skills.

  • Develop effective communications to build, enhance, and sustain advisors' knowledge and confidence with mutual fund and investing conversations.
  • Craft and/or edit compelling and contextual original content for use in various marketing and communications activities, sales enablement campaigns, advisor onboarding and training, and digital tools.
  • Lead the development, production, and distribution of accurate and timely communications for assigned products, including FAQs, advisor resources, presentations, portfolio manager calls/webinars, commentaries, regulatory communications, fact sheets, fund profiles, videos, and investor communications.
  • Lead communication activities for fund launches, mergers, changes, and ongoing maintenance of recurring product communications, working closely with Portfolio Managers, Compliance, Operations, Marketing, internal business teams, and external vendors.


Product Experience: Cultivate the growth of compelling product and investment-focused communications, resources, tools, and experiences for advisor, internal, and client audiences.

  • Leverage market insights, digital trends, and competitive analysis to drive the development of product and investment support for multiple brands and channels.
  • Act as a mutual fund/product subject matter expert for National Sales, Learning & Performance, Advice & Service Excellence, Marketing, and other functional groups.
  • Conduct, oversee, and/or support appropriate business line testing to ensure business requirements are fulfilled for product and investment-focused digital initiatives.
  • Lead and/or support research initiatives for the Scotia Global Asset Management Product team, including the annual investor sentiment survey.
  • Establish close working relationships with key distribution channels, actively soliciting feedback on existing and new support. Respond to all inquiries and requests for product support, balancing the complexity of the ask with the value delivered.
  • Partner with various Marketing functions to ensure business needs, brand, presentation, and accessibility standards are met.
  • Ensure all tactics are developed, delivered, and maintained in compliance with governing regulations, internal policies, and procedures.
  • Understand how the Bank's risk appetite and risk culture should be considered in day-to-day activities and decisions.
